Service Warranty Booker at Arrigo CDJR Fort Pierce

Arrigo CDJR Fort Pierce is hiring a Booker for the service department. Key Responsibilities:

  • Researches, connects, and resubmits rejected claims within 5 days
  • Reconciles Vendor Accounts
  • Maintains accurate filing system or parts to be shipped back to factory or distributor, or to be scrapped.
  • Builds productive working relationships; consults with others as necessary.
  • Maintain positive, professional working relationships in all situations with department employees.
  • Analyzes problems, identifies trends, and develops strategies to maximize claim process.
  • Completes reports as established by dealership
  • Applies information found in manuals publications, bulletins, and other documents.
  • Maintains an organized and professional environment.
  • Provides technical information and assistance to employees as needed.
  • Verifies history of vehicles prior to claim submission to audit mileage, in service date, and past repair history.

Qualifications:

  • Proficiency in Excel, including basic formulas & V LOOKUP.
  • Strong attention to detail, integrity and work ethic.
  • Ability to multi-task and prioritize in fast-paced environment.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with peers and customers.
  • Experience with automotive software (Reynolds and Reynolds or ADP) is a plus.
